On December 7, 2017, a delegation consisted of school principals and vice-principals (Albanians and Serbs) from primary and secondary schools from Kosovo as well as OSCE representatives visited one of the most successful schools that works according to the Nansen model for intercultural education, the municipal primary school Goce Delcev in Gostivar. The visit to the school was organized by the school management, teachers and students included in the Nansen intercultural activities. The guests had the opportunity to attend the intercultural extracurricular activities that are carried out bilingually, in Macedonian and Albanian language in order to get more closely acquainted with the teaching methodology applied in ethnically-mixed groups of students. After the visit to the school, the delegation visited NDC Skopje and Training Centre premises, where they were presented more closely with the work in the Nansen schools and project activities, as well as the work of the Training Centre for Intercultural education.
